Hovercraft Charity Event

On Saturday 21 February 2009, Warren Secker of Hov Pod Hovercraft Australia, and his family, ran free rides on the Hov Pod, in exchange for a donation to the Victoria Bushfire Appeal.

The Hov Pod flew for almost five hours from 9:30am, in perfect conditions, with no wind and mirror like water, stopping only for fuel. Over 100 smiling people, ranging from an 18 month old little girl to a couple in their 70's had the opportunity to fly across the sand and over the crystal clear water in Raby Bay, experiencing slides and 360 degree spins. Some people even donated twice so they could experience it a second time.

Warren and his family would like to thank the wonderful people who attended, as without their kindness and generosity, they would not have been able to raise almost $600 for the cause.

Hovercraft Experience 2009

A number of Hov Pod dealers and rental operators now offer hovercraft experience rides and hovercraft training. If you haven't experienced hovercraft flying before, then you have something to really look forward to.

Our mini cruiser Hovercraft are built for safety and comfort, though they can reach a top speed of in excess of 40 mph. You fly above the ground at a typical cruising altitude of 9 inches. Hovercraft are especially exciting when traveling over land to water to land transitions.

The ride sensation is hard to put into words, but imagine that you are levitating on a "Back-to-the-Future" type hovercar where you have no contact with the ground. As you are floating, it feels really comfortable, and as you let the revs increase, a blast of air will gently speed you on your way. No wheels, or brakes for that matter, so you can either stop by slowly reducing your speed, or by effecting a controlled 360 spin.

Hovercraft flying is so wonderfully addictive, so make a day of it and bring your friends for a great day out.
